RENSSELAER — Irene Sorriento was fired from her job as human resources manager of the city of Rensselaer when Democrat John DeFrancesco became mayor in January.
Now, the Republican bureaucrat says she is the preferred candidate for the same civil service job from which she was terminated. Another county official familiar with the matter corroborates her claim.
Sorriento, who currently serves as Rensselaer County civil service director, said on April 24 that she received a canvass letter regarding the city position from a fellow department staffer, Jeanette Stanton. (The county has managed civil service matters for the city for more than a decade.) In a response to the letter, Sorriento expressed interest in her former job…
